Today we’re going to show you how an expert builder, Paul Flury, places the necessary wiring for the devices in the first floor ceiling. In this photo grouping, for example, we see fixtures placed between the heavy timbers on the Tongue & Groove, track lighting on the side of heavy timbers, and a ceiling fan mounted directly to the underside of an exposed beam. THAT is a very important question – and it’s one we get all the time.Ī log home is different than a conventional home, but with proper planning, you can have electrical fixtures, switches and outlets placed wherever you need or want them.
